<h1>Application to Regional Director for extensions, branch openings/closures, intimations, or withdrawal of unencumbered deposits by Nidhi companies.</h1> Form NDH-2 sets out the procedure for Nidhi companies to apply to the Regional Director for extension of time, permission to open or close branches, or withdrawal of unencumbered deposits, and to intimate the Registrar about branch or collection centre changes; it requires company identification, purpose of application, financial position (including number of members and ratio of net owned funds to deposits), reasons and justification, board resolution authorising filing, audited financial statements and other attachments, certification by an authorised officer or practicing professional, and a declaration acknowledging penal consequences for false statements under the Companies Act.
